EMPIRE AIRMEN

PLANS FOR HOSPITALITY (By Telegraph.-- IT<‘" \--nelil!i"ll • WELLINGTON, Friday The Minister ol‘ Defence, the Hon. F. Jones, has been advised of plans by the National Council of the Canadian Y.W.C.A. to provide suitable hospitality and entertainment for students at Empire training schools during periods of leave from camp, including opportunities of meeting Canadian people in their own homes.
